New Mexico State
Synopsis: New Mexico State disclosed the number of tests administered and the number of positives, but said no other information could be released, due to privacy laws. The program doesn't operate on a budget, officials said, with bills instead being paid whenever testing is performed. The university reported no audits, drug-testing vendor contract nor bidding documents.
